dsh-pm is a tool for DeepSeek Harness. dsh-pm is the ChunSun × DeepSeek Harness reference plugin: an AI-native project-delivery loop driven by ChunSun. Requirements / Runs / Steps / acceptance scenarios & cases / work-memory, a session delivery panel, and 28 chunsun_* model tools — with the platform as the single source of truth. MIT.
